Izan Guevara has been officially promoted to MotoGP with Pramac Yamaha for the 2027 season, replacing Jack Miller, who announced his departure earlier today. This completes the rider line-up for Yamaha's two premier-class squads.
The 22-year-old Spaniard, a product of Yamaha's BLU CRU development programme, will partner Toprak Razgatlioglu. Guevara arrives on the back of an impressive Moto2 campaign, currently second in the standings, 42.5 points behind leader Manu Gonzales.
"This is a dream come true for me," said Guevara. "Reaching MotoGP has always been my goal, and I know how difficult it is to arrive in the premier class. It has taken many years of hard work and sacrifices from a lot of people around me." He added that his immediate focus remains on fighting for the Moto2 title.

Guevara's world championship career has been a rollercoaster. After winning the Moto3 title in his second season with Aspar, he struggled in his first Moto2 year in 2023. But a switch to Pramac's Moto2 squad last season transformed his fortunes, yielding a first win at Valencia and a strong title bid this year with victories at Le Mans and podiums at Austin and the Sachsenring.
Yamaha boss Paolo Pavesio praised Guevara's maturity and growth. "We have known Izan's talent for many years," he said. "After two challenging seasons in Moto2, we made a mutual commitment to help him reach MotoGP. Throughout that journey, he has shown exactly what we hoped to see—work ethic, determination, consistency, and the ability to continuously improve."
The decision also aligns with MotoGP's new regulations set to arrive in 2027, which Pavesio believes offer an ideal opportunity for Guevara to adapt to the new machinery and prove the value of Yamaha's development pathway.
